On to the Bugeye Project... Land Speed racing is all about Aerodynamics...
and Hp... but mostly Aero stuff....  and Rolling resistance to some
degree....

Playing with the folks out there means you gotta play by their rules...
which means the Bugeye is going to have a 130 inch wheelbase and the stock
rear Track... the front wheel track is yet to be decided but I am thinking
I am going to narrow it a ton..... anyway... on to you question about what
it will look like... well it has to have a stock body from the cowl back...
Period... it must be pure stock
forward of the cowl you can do anything you think is fast.... so it will be
very very stream lined...

as for tires... I am running all the tires that I am going to use on the
bugeye currently.. I have three sets of rears and two sets of fronts.. they
are a combination of Goodyear Front runners and Mickey Thompson Bonneville
tires... they are skinny... like 6 inches wide and range from 25-28 inches
tall
it depends on which motor we are running....each Motor likes a different
RPM range... 

our best motor is a 1968 Chevrolet 302 destroked to a 296 cu in... and it
puts out around 650-700hp...
the dyno says more but I don't believe it... anyway.... if you can get that
out of a Healey Motor send me the Mounting locations and I will be happy to
run it in the car... but on my own I am going to run  the Chevrolet stuff
cause parts are plentiful and Relatively Cheap.... if you consider 20,000
cheap...

I am considering running dual turbo chargers in the sprite with an
electronic fuel injection also... which should make the car scoot....

going as fast as Donald Healey was my original goal... then I saw the
Record for Modified Sports.. and decided that was My Record....to have at
232MPH.... then I got to thinking and away we went.... yeah the car is
